I think you are underestimating Decker. He can DEFINITELY play RT, probably come in, start and be an upgrade over Breno. He is incredibly strong and stout. Very good in the run game-  a mauler with a mean streak. He worked a lot on his game throughout his career at OSU and got a lot better. He's more suited to play OT than OG b/c of his height/length but he is def. strong enough to play OG. I DO believe he can transition to LT in the NFL (he played LT in college against high level competition and won a championship). He is more polished than Spriggs or even Stanley at this point, which is why I think he can step right in and play RT in the NFL. The knock on him and the reason that some don't see him as an NFL LT is b/c he's not as athletic as scouts would want a LT prospect to be. But he has all the other attributes and lack of athleticism has not held him back on the football field. I think he has a higher ceiling than some may think. He's been unfairly pegged as an NFL RT, even though that is not the position he plays.

I think his biggest weaknesses are. 1. Allows defenders to raise his bad level and get up into him at times due to his height. 2. Struggles at the 2nd level due to his height and lack of athleticism which is required once you are out in the open blocking defensive backs. 3. Sometimes a speedy edge rusher will get the best of him if they are able to get around him. 

But, to me, these are not major and can be improved with better footwork and technique, particularly #1 and #3.
